Skip to content

Commit 2a57889

Browse files
committed
Merge branch 'DLS-Release-v1.2.1' into UAT
2 parents 752e4c3 + b395ce1 commit 2a57889

File tree

4 files changed

+170
-170
lines changed

4 files changed

+170
-170
lines changed

DigitalLearningSolutions.Data/DataServices/FrameworkDataService.cs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-291,7 +291,7 @@ FROM FrameworkCollaborators fc
291291
JOIN AdminAccounts aa1 ON fc.AdminID = aa1.ID
292292
WHERE fc.FrameworkID = fw.ID
293293
AND fc.CanModify = 1 AND fc.IsDeleted = 0
294-
AND aa1.UserID = (SELECT aa2.UserID FROM AdminAccounts aa2 WHERE aa2.ID = 12842)) > 0 THEN 2
294+
AND aa1.UserID = (SELECT aa2.UserID FROM AdminAccounts aa2 WHERE aa2.ID = @adminId)) > 0 THEN 2
295295
WHEN fwc.CanModify = 0 THEN 1 ELSE 0 END AS UserRole,
296296
fwr.ID AS FrameworkReviewID";
297297

DigitalLearningSolutions.Web/Views/Frameworks/Developer/_MyFrameworks.cshtml

Lines changed: 87 additions & 87 deletions
Original file line numberDiff line numberDiff line change
@@ -3,100 +3,100 @@
33
<h1>My Frameworks</h1>
44
@if (Model.NoDataFound)
55
{
6-
<p class="nhsuk-u-margin-top-4" role="alert">
7-
<b>You are not currently working on any frameworks.</b>
8-
</p>
6+
<p class="nhsuk-u-margin-top-4" role="alert">
7+
<b>You are not currently working on any frameworks.</b>
8+
</p>
99
}
1010
else
1111
{
12-
<form method="get" role="search" asp-action="ViewFrameworks" asp-route-tabname="Mine" asp-route-page="@Model.Page">
12+
<form method="get" role="search" asp-action="ViewFrameworks" asp-route-tabname="Mine" asp-route-page="@Model.Page">
1313

14-
<partial name="Shared/_FrameworksSearchAndSort" model="Model" />
14+
<partial name="Shared/_FrameworksSearchAndSort" model="Model" />
1515

16-
<hr class="nhsuk-u-margin-top-3 nhsuk-u-margin-bottom-4" />
17-
<partial name="SearchablePage/_SearchResultsCount" model="Model" />
18-
<partial name="SearchablePage/_TopPagination" model="Model" />
19-
<partial name="SearchablePage/_ResultCountAndPageAlerts" model="Model" />
20-
@if (Model.MatchingSearchResults > 0)
21-
{
22-
<table role="table" class="nhsuk-table-responsive">
23-
<caption class="nhsuk-table__caption nhsuk-u-visually-hidden">Frameworks you are working on</caption>
24-
<thead role="rowgroup" class="nhsuk-table__head">
25-
<tr role="row">
26-
<th role="columnheader" class="" scope="col">
27-
Framework
28-
</th>
29-
<th role="columnheader" class="" scope="col">
30-
Created
31-
</th>
32-
<th role="columnheader" class="" scope="col">
33-
Status
34-
</th>
35-
<th role="columnheader" class="" scope="col">
36-
Owner
37-
</th>
38-
<th role="columnheader" class="" scope="col">
39-
Actions
40-
</th>
41-
</tr>
42-
</thead>
43-
<tbody class="nhsuk-table__body">
44-
@foreach (var framework in Model.BrandedFrameworks)
45-
{
46-
<tr role="row" class="nhsuk-table__row framework-row">
47-
<td role="cell" class="nhsuk-table__cell">
48-
<span class="nhsuk-table-responsive__heading">Framework </span>
49-
<span class="framework-name">
50-
@framework.FrameworkName
51-
</span>
52-
</td>
53-
<td role="cell" class="nhsuk-table__cell">
54-
<span class="nhsuk-table-responsive__heading">Created </span>
55-
<span class="framework-created-date">
56-
@framework.CreatedDate.ToShortDateString()
57-
</span>
58-
</td>
59-
<td role="cell" class="nhsuk-table__cell">
60-
<span class="nhsuk-table-responsive__heading">Status </span>
61-
<span class="framework-publish-status">
62-
<partial name="Shared/_StatusTag" model="framework.PublishStatusID" />
63-
</span>
64-
</td>
65-
<td role="cell" class="nhsuk-table__cell">
66-
<span class="nhsuk-table-responsive__heading">Owner </span>
67-
<span class="framework-owner">
68-
@framework.Owner
69-
</span>
70-
</td>
71-
<td role="cell" class="nhsuk-table__cell">
72-
<span class="nhsuk-table-responsive__heading">Actions </span>
73-
@if (framework.UserRole > 1)
74-
{
75-
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
76-
View/Edit
77-
<span class="visually-hidden">@framework.FrameworkName</span>
78-
</a>
79-
}
80-
else if (framework.UserRole == 1)
81-
{
82-
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
83-
Review
84-
<span class="visually-hidden">@framework.FrameworkName</span>
85-
</a>
86-
}
87-
</td>
88-
</tr>
89-
}
90-
</tbody>
91-
</table>
92-
}
93-
<partial name="SearchablePage/_BottomPagination" model="Model" />
16+
<hr class="nhsuk-u-margin-top-3 nhsuk-u-margin-bottom-4" />
17+
<partial name="SearchablePage/_SearchResultsCount" model="Model" />
18+
<partial name="SearchablePage/_TopPagination" model="Model" />
19+
<partial name="SearchablePage/_ResultCountAndPageAlerts" model="Model" />
20+
@if (Model.MatchingSearchResults > 0)
21+
{
22+
<table role="table" class="nhsuk-table-responsive">
23+
<caption class="nhsuk-table__caption nhsuk-u-visually-hidden">Frameworks you are working on</caption>
24+
<thead role="rowgroup" class="nhsuk-table__head">
25+
<tr role="row">
26+
<th role="columnheader" class="" scope="col">
27+
Framework
28+
</th>
29+
<th role="columnheader" class="" scope="col">
30+
Created
31+
</th>
32+
<th role="columnheader" class="" scope="col">
33+
Status
34+
</th>
35+
<th role="columnheader" class="" scope="col">
36+
Owner
37+
</th>
38+
<th role="columnheader" class="" scope="col">
39+
Actions
40+
</th>
41+
</tr>
42+
</thead>
43+
<tbody class="nhsuk-table__body">
44+
@foreach (var framework in Model.BrandedFrameworks)
45+
{
46+
<tr role="row" class="nhsuk-table__row framework-row">
47+
<td role="cell" class="nhsuk-table__cell">
48+
<span class="nhsuk-table-responsive__heading">Framework </span>
49+
<span class="framework-name">
50+
@framework.FrameworkName
51+
</span>
52+
</td>
53+
<td role="cell" class="nhsuk-table__cell">
54+
<span class="nhsuk-table-responsive__heading">Created </span>
55+
<span class="framework-created-date">
56+
@framework.CreatedDate.ToShortDateString()
57+
</span>
58+
</td>
59+
<td role="cell" class="nhsuk-table__cell">
60+
<span class="nhsuk-table-responsive__heading">Status </span>
61+
<span class="framework-publish-status">
62+
<partial name="Shared/_StatusTag" model="framework.PublishStatusID" />
63+
</span>
64+
</td>
65+
<td role="cell" class="nhsuk-table__cell">
66+
<span class="nhsuk-table-responsive__heading">Owner </span>
67+
<span class="framework-owner">
68+
@framework.Owner
69+
</span>
70+
</td>
71+
<td role="cell" class="nhsuk-table__cell">
72+
<span class="nhsuk-table-responsive__heading">Actions </span>
73+
@if (framework.UserRole > 1)
74+
{
75+
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
76+
View/Edit
77+
<span class="visually-hidden">@framework.FrameworkName</span>
78+
</a>
79+
}
80+
else if (framework.UserRole == 1)
81+
{
82+
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
83+
@(framework.FrameworkReviewID == null ? "View" : "Review")
84+
<span class="visually-hidden">@framework.FrameworkName</span>
85+
</a>
86+
}
87+
</td>
88+
</tr>
89+
}
90+
</tbody>
91+
</table>
92+
}
93+
<partial name="SearchablePage/_BottomPagination" model="Model" />
9494

95-
</form>
95+
</form>
9696
}
9797
@if (Model.IsFrameworkDeveloper)
9898
{
99-
<a class="nhsuk-button nhsuk-u-margin-top-4" asp-action="StartNewFrameworkSession">
100-
Create new framework
101-
</a>
99+
<a class="nhsuk-button nhsuk-u-margin-top-4" asp-action="StartNewFrameworkSession">
100+
Create new framework
101+
</a>
102102
}

DigitalLearningSolutions.Web/Views/Frameworks/Shared/_BrandedFrameworkTable.cshtml

Lines changed: 78 additions & 78 deletions
Original file line numberDiff line numberDiff line change
@@ -2,85 +2,85 @@
22
@model IEnumerable<BrandedFramework>
33
@if (Model != null && Model.Count() > 0)
44
{
5-
<table role="table" class="nhsuk-table-responsive">
6-
<caption class="nhsuk-table__caption nhsuk-u-visually-hidden">
7-
Frameworks
8-
</caption>
9-
<thead role="rowgroup" class="nhsuk-table__head">
10-
<tr role="row">
11-
<th role="columnheader" class="" scope="col">
12-
Framework
13-
</th>
14-
<th role="columnheader" class="" scope="col">
15-
Created
16-
</th>
17-
<th role="columnheader" class="" scope="col">
18-
Status
19-
</th>
20-
<th role="columnheader" class="" scope="col">
21-
Owner
22-
</th>
23-
<th role="columnheader" class="" scope="col">
24-
Actions
25-
</th>
26-
</tr>
27-
</thead>
28-
<tbody class="nhsuk-table__body">
29-
@foreach (var framework in Model)
30-
{
31-
<tr role="row" class="nhsuk-table__row framework-row">
32-
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
33-
<span class="nhsuk-table-responsive__heading">Framework </span>
34-
<span class="framework-brand">
35-
@framework.Brand
36-
</span>
37-
@if (framework.Category != null)
5+
<table role="table" class="nhsuk-table-responsive">
6+
<caption class="nhsuk-table__caption nhsuk-u-visually-hidden">
7+
Frameworks
8+
</caption>
9+
<thead role="rowgroup" class="nhsuk-table__head">
10+
<tr role="row">
11+
<th role="columnheader" class="" scope="col">
12+
Framework
13+
</th>
14+
<th role="columnheader" class="" scope="col">
15+
Created
16+
</th>
17+
<th role="columnheader" class="" scope="col">
18+
Status
19+
</th>
20+
<th role="columnheader" class="" scope="col">
21+
Owner
22+
</th>
23+
<th role="columnheader" class="" scope="col">
24+
Actions
25+
</th>
26+
</tr>
27+
</thead>
28+
<tbody class="nhsuk-table__body">
29+
@foreach (var framework in Model)
3830
{
39-
<span>/</span>
31+
<tr role="row" class="nhsuk-table__row framework-row">
32+
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
33+
<span class="nhsuk-table-responsive__heading">Framework </span>
34+
<span class="framework-brand">
35+
@framework.Brand
36+
</span>
37+
@if (framework.Category != null)
38+
{
39+
<span>/</span>
4040

41-
<span class="framework-category"> @framework.Category </span>
42-
}<span>/</span>
43-
<span class="framework-name nhsuk-u-font-weight-bold">
44-
@framework.FrameworkName
45-
</span>
46-
</td>
47-
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
48-
<span class="nhsuk-table-responsive__heading">Created </span>
49-
<span class="framework-created-date">
50-
@framework.CreatedDate.ToShortDateString()
51-
</span>
52-
</td>
53-
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
54-
<span class="nhsuk-table-responsive__heading">Status </span>
55-
<span class="framework-publish-status">
56-
<partial name="Shared/_StatusTag" model="framework.PublishStatusID" />
57-
</span>
58-
</td>
59-
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
60-
<span class="nhsuk-table-responsive__heading">Owner </span>
61-
<span class="framework-owner">
62-
@framework.Owner
63-
</span>
64-
</td>
65-
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
66-
<span class="nhsuk-table-responsive__heading">Actions </span>
67-
@if (framework.UserRole > 1)
68-
{
69-
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
70-
View/Edit
71-
<span class="visually-hidden">@framework.FrameworkName</span>
72-
</a>
73-
}
74-
else
75-
{
76-
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
77-
View
78-
<span class="visually-hidden">@framework.FrameworkName</span>
79-
</a>
41+
<span class="framework-category"> @framework.Category </span>
42+
}<span>/</span>
43+
<span class="framework-name nhsuk-u-font-weight-bold">
44+
@framework.FrameworkName
45+
</span>
46+
</td>
47+
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
48+
<span class="nhsuk-table-responsive__heading">Created </span>
49+
<span class="framework-created-date">
50+
@framework.CreatedDate.ToShortDateString()
51+
</span>
52+
</td>
53+
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
54+
<span class="nhsuk-table-responsive__heading">Status </span>
55+
<span class="framework-publish-status">
56+
<partial name="Shared/_StatusTag" model="framework.PublishStatusID" />
57+
</span>
58+
</td>
59+
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
60+
<span class="nhsuk-table-responsive__heading">Owner </span>
61+
<span class="framework-owner">
62+
@framework.Owner
63+
</span>
64+
</td>
65+
<td role="cell" class="nhsuk-table__cell nhsuk-u-font-size-16">
66+
<span class="nhsuk-table-responsive__heading">Actions </span>
67+
@if (framework.UserRole > 1)
68+
{
69+
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
70+
View/Edit
71+
<span class="visually-hidden">@framework.FrameworkName</span>
72+
</a>
73+
}
74+
else
75+
{
76+
<a asp-action="ViewFramework" asp-route-frameworkId="@framework.ID" asp-route-tabname="Structure">
77+
@(framework.FrameworkReviewID == null ? "View" : "Review")
78+
<span class="visually-hidden">@framework.FrameworkName</span>
79+
</a>
80+
}
81+
</td>
82+
</tr>
8083
}
81-
</td>
82-
</tr>
83-
}
84-
</tbody>
85-
</table>
84+
</tbody>
85+
</table>
8686
}

DigitalLearningSolutions.Web/Views/Supervisor/VerifyMultipleResults.cshtml

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-130,17 +130,17 @@
130130
<span class="nhsuk-table-responsive__heading">@competency.Vocabulary </span>
131131
<div class="nhsuk-checkboxes__item">
132132
<input data-group="@competencyGroup.Key" class="nhsuk-checkboxes__input select-all-checkbox" id="result-check-@question.SelfAssessmentResultSupervisorVerificationId" name="resultChecked" type="checkbox" value="@question.SelfAssessmentResultSupervisorVerificationId">
133-
<label aria-label="Competency.Name" class="@(string.IsNullOrEmpty(competency.Description) ? "nhsuk-label nhsuk-checkboxes__label nhsuk-u-font-size-16" : "nhsuk-label nhsuk-checkboxes__label nhsuk-u-padding-0 nhsuk-u-display-block")" for="result-check-@question.SelfAssessmentResultSupervisorVerificationId">
134-
@if (competency.Description == null)
133+
<label aria-label="Competency.Name" class="@(string.IsNullOrWhiteSpace(competency.Description) ? "nhsuk-label nhsuk-checkboxes__label nhsuk-u-font-size-19" : "nhsuk-label nhsuk-checkboxes__label nhsuk-u-padding-0 nhsuk-u-display-block")" for="result-check-@question.SelfAssessmentResultSupervisorVerificationId">
134+
@if (string.IsNullOrWhiteSpace(competency.Description))
135135
{
136136
@competency.Name
137137
}
138138
</label>
139-
@if (!string.IsNullOrEmpty(competency.Description))
139+
@if (!string.IsNullOrWhiteSpace(competency.Description))
140140
{
141141
<details class="nhsuk-details nhsuk-u-padding-left-2 ">
142142
<summary class="nhsuk-details__summary nhsuk-u-padding-left-2">
143-
<span class="nhsuk-label nhsuk-checkboxes__label nhsuk-u-font-size-16 " for="result-check-@question.SelfAssessmentResultSupervisorVerificationId">
143+
<span class="nhsuk-label nhsuk-checkboxes__label nhsuk-u-font-size-19 " for="result-check-@question.SelfAssessmentResultSupervisorVerificationId">
144144
@competency.Name
145145
</span>
146146
</summary>

0 commit comments

Comments
 (0)